'Yeh Dil Maange More': How Captain Vikram Batra captured Point 5140 on this day 27 years ago
Indian Army achieved a pivotal victory at Point 5140, the highest point on the Tololing ridgeline, on June 20, 1999. This strategic capture, led by Captain Sanjeev Singh Jamwal and Captain Vikram Batra, crucial for controlling the Dras sector and the Srinagar-Leh National Highway, was announced with distinct success signals. The triumph paved the way for further Indian advances, marking a turning point in the Kargil War.

White House clears rule limiting status of foreign students in US that many have opposed
The White House has greenlit a new rule from the Department of Homeland Security that will end the open-ended stay for foreign students, exchange visitors, and media representatives. Instead, these individuals will now receive a fixed four-year admission period, requiring them to renew their status. This change aims to reduce overstays and enhance national security, though critics warn of administrative burdens.

China's economy struggles to regain domestic momentum despite export boom: Report
Despite strong export growth, China's domestic economy faces significant challenges. Consumer spending saw a decline in May, with retail sales falling for the first time since late 2022. Consumer confidence remains low, and credit demand is weak, indicating reluctance from businesses and households to borrow. The property sector continues to struggle, though some major cities show signs of stabilization. Semiconductor exports, however, are a notable bright spot, surging significantly.
